ജോലി വിവരണം

Job purpose

The Clinical Project Manager will be responsible for planning and executing project management activities and overseeing clinical operations so that research-related work runs efficiently and without disruption.

Key responsibilities

  • Serve as the main point of contact for sponsors associated with assigned studies.
  • Guide and coordinate cross-functional team leads as well as external partners and vendors.
  • Track and manage contractual deliverables, including milestone payments and insurance qualification requirements.
  • Control project scope and costs in a timely manner to reduce financial exposure.
  • Make sure project work follows company SOPs, policies, and internal guidelines.
  • Confirm that projects are aligned with Tigermed systems and workflows such as CTMS, OA, eTMF, and related tools, while escalating issues to the appropriate functional or operational leaders when needed.
  • Take part actively in bid defense preparation and discussions.
  • Provide training support to project team members and help strengthen overall team effectiveness.
  • Share performance feedback on project team members with the relevant line managers.

Qualifications and requirements

  • A bachelor’s degree or higher in Medicine, Pharmacology, Biology, or a closely related field is preferred. A college diploma may also be accepted if the candidate demonstrates strong personal qualities and relevant project management experience.
  • Strong understanding of drug development processes and current regulatory requirements, including local regulations, GCP, and clinical trial operations. A current GCP certificate is required. Business knowledge and budgeting ability are an added advantage.
  • At least 10 years of industry experience, with a minimum of 6 years in project management. Experience in a CRO environment is preferred. Candidates with exceptional project management achievements may also be considered.
  • Fluency in both written and spoken English is required; knowledge of local languages is preferred.
  •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Office tools is expected.
  • Strong project management and time management capabilities are essential.
